I feel privileged to have made it to the final three in the Emerging Business category, at the Sligo Business Awards in the Radisson Blu Hotel Sligo last evening.

The Sligo Champion and Sligo Leader,Partnership put on a fantastic event, which was attended by over four hundred people. The Radisson blu hotel served a beautiful meal while we all chatted and networked. Master of ceremonies Lorraine O’Donnell (GM the Sligo Champion) kept us all engaged as she announced all of the shortlisted finalists in each category and each perspective category winner.

The very successful, Terry Prone (Carr Communications) was guest speaker. She delivered an entertaining speech on communication, a topic she has huge expertise in due to over 50 years in the media and communications industry. She encourages females to be unapologetic for having successful careers and to loose the guilt, as she says “children are very adaptable”.

The common theme running through the evening was the importance of networking with other businesses and helping each other in any way we can., this was reiterated by Chris Gonley (CEO Sligo Leader partnership). Marketing ourselves through all of the various channels whether in print media, social media or TV and radio, is essential to our survival. Having clarity on what message we want to portray and who we want to deliver that to is key to success.
